電子產(chǎn)業(yè)一站式賦能平臺

PCB聯(lián)盟網(wǎng)

搜索
查看: 4467|回復(fù): 0
收起左側(cè)

這張能運(yùn)行Linux系統(tǒng)的PCB名片,肯定能讓你眼前一亮

[復(fù)制鏈接]

2607

主題

2607

帖子

7472

積分

高級會員

Rank: 5Rank: 5

積分
7472
跳轉(zhuǎn)到指定樓層
樓主
發(fā)表于 2020-7-16 15:57:39 | 只看該作者 回帖獎勵 |倒序瀏覽 |閱讀模式
“  要說到最具極客范的名片,下面這張能運(yùn)行Linux系統(tǒng)的PCB名片,肯定能讓你眼前一亮!

  

這張能運(yùn)行Linux系統(tǒng)的名片出自嵌入式系統(tǒng)工程師George Hilliard之手,整張名片僅銀行卡大小,超薄、實用,并且花費(fèi)還不到3美元。

制作這樣一張名片,除了需要一定的理論知識,使用的元器件也要足夠便宜,即使將名片發(fā)給別人也不用心疼。而處理器是保持低成本的關(guān)鍵,George經(jīng)過大量對比調(diào)研,最后在這張名片中采用了全志科技F1C100s芯片,這顆小巧的高性價比芯片在單個封裝中同時提供RAMCPU,大大簡化了名片的整體設(shè)計和構(gòu)造。

不少極客朋友也曾制作過各種有趣的創(chuàng)意名片,包括 U 盤名片、帶閃光燈的名片,甚至帶無線電首發(fā)功能的名片,不過暫時還沒有可以運(yùn)行 Linux 系統(tǒng)的名片出現(xiàn)。作為一名資深極客,George 自己動手做了一張:

  

這是一臺完整的,也是最小的 ARM 架構(gòu)計算機(jī),運(yùn)行由 Buildroot 構(gòu)建的定制 Linux 固件。

名片上印有 George 的姓名、職位、電子郵箱等常規(guī)信息,其中一角還帶有 USB 接口。將這張名片插入計算機(jī)后,它將在 6 秒內(nèi)啟動。借助只需2.4 MB容量的根文件系統(tǒng),這個PCB上運(yùn)行的環(huán)境可謂是最精簡的。

  

這樣一張成本不到3美元的名片,卻已經(jīng)擁有如此多的功能,難怪George的文章一天之內(nèi)就在Hacker News上收獲2000多贊。下面,讓我們來看看他是如何做到的吧。

設(shè)計和組裝

George作為一位工程師,十分享受親手設(shè)計并制作這張創(chuàng)意名片,但要找到足夠便宜的元器件的確是件麻煩事。

經(jīng)過一番調(diào)研, George選擇了全志科技的一款高性價比的芯片--F1C100s。這款芯片在成本優(yōu)化上下足了功夫,同時集成了 RAM 與 CPU,在功能上完全滿足要求。這款芯片可以在淘寶上買到,而其他元器件均購自LCSC。

George使用 JLC 制作了 PCB 板子,只花8美元便得到了10塊電路板,磨砂質(zhì)感的啞光黑表面,質(zhì)量不錯,價格也實惠。

第一次制作電路板時還是有點小問題:首先,USB 端口不夠長,因此很難與許多的 USB 接口穩(wěn)定連接;其次,芯片引腳有錯,最后George通過手動彎曲調(diào)整。

  

George 使用焊錫手動焊接這些小尺寸的元器件。當(dāng)然,這些被使用的板材和元器件的都是無鉛、無害的,用來作為名片遞交出去也完全沒問題。

這里附上完整的物料成本:

  

當(dāng)然,George也表明還有很多成本并不能量化,例如運(yùn)費(fèi)和試錯成本等等。但對于一塊能運(yùn)行 Linux 系統(tǒng)的板子來說,3美元的成本已經(jīng)非常低了。

性能怎么樣?



  

這張名片上還存放了George的個人簡歷和一些照片,這畢竟是一張名片。所有用戶都可以將其通過USB端口接入到電腦中,通過虛擬串行接口登錄root賬戶,訪問卡片上的系統(tǒng)程序。

制作名片需要哪些資源?

在制作電路板名片的過程中,George 使用了 F1C100s 芯片,并在上面運(yùn)行主流的 Linux 5.2 版本。最后,George 上傳了制作電路板名片的原理圖,并在GitHub上開源了所有的代碼。

  

電路板名片原理圖

George在原文中分享了詳細(xì)的操作步驟,為感興趣的極客朋友們提供了更多的技術(shù)細(xì)節(jié)。相信通過他提供的所有源代碼和步驟分享,你也可以做出這樣別具一格的個人名片。

全志科技F1C100s  高清多媒體處理器

  

全志F1C100s集成了高清視頻解碼、高集成、低功耗的領(lǐng)先技術(shù),適用于多種多媒體音視頻設(shè)備。F1C100s 采用ARM9 CPU,具有卓越的系統(tǒng)集成能力、豐富的接口,支持低功耗應(yīng)用程序及Melis、Linux等操作系統(tǒng),大幅提升開發(fā)便利性。

通過創(chuàng)新,讓生活更加便利、有趣,也許這就是我們所說的“極客范兒”。你是否也有這樣的“極客范兒”想法?試著行動起來,相信你的創(chuàng)意會讓我們大呼過癮,如果需要全志的幫助,也歡迎直接聯(lián)系我們。
回復(fù)

使用道具 舉報

發(fā)表回復(fù)

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規(guī)則


聯(lián)系客服 關(guān)注微信 下載APP 返回頂部 返回列表